About Sydney, Nova Scotia
Sydney, Nova Scotia has emerged as a vibrant cruise destination on Canada's Atlantic coast, attracting eleven major cruise lines including Holland America Line, Royal Caribbean International, Celebrity Cruises, and Norwegian Cruise Line. With 158 upcoming cruises and a strong presence of expedition operators like PONANT and Silversea, this charming port offers diverse sailing options. Most cruises departing from Sydney span 14 nights, with peak seasons running from May through October, making it an ideal embarkation point for exploring the maritime provinces and New England.
As a port of call, Sydney welcomes cruise passengers to experience the rich maritime heritage and natural beauty of Cape Breton Island. Visitors can explore the historic Louisbourg Fortress, a meticulously restored 18th-century military outpost, or venture into the stunning landscapes of nearby national parks. The port's strategic location also makes it a perfect launching point for longer itineraries visiting Halifax, Quebec City, Boston, and charming ports like Charlottetown and Portland, allowing cruisers to experience the best of Canada's Atlantic region.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is Sydney, Nova Scotia known for?
A gateway to Cape Breton with a revitalized waterfront and Loyalist-era buildings.
What are must-see attractions near Sydney?
Fortress Louisbourg, Miner’s Museum, and Bras d'Or Lake are popular nearby.
When is the best time to visit Sydney?
Late spring to early fall offers milder weather and outdoor activities.
How can I access Sydney from other parts of Nova Scotia?
By road via Highway 105 or ferry connections to Cape Breton Island.
